Photograph was edited for publication purposes Photograph caption dated August 2, 1956 reads, "Motorists who have been forced to detour from area of Ventura boulevard west of Sepulveda boulevard because of construction work on San Diego Freeway overpass will find landscape slightly changed. This picture was taken from under bridge looking east along Ventura toward Sepulveda."; See images #00115029 through #00115031 for all photos in this series.
